The Importance of Bonus Structures
Bonus structures are a cornerstone of the online casino experience, serving as incentives for both new and existing players. However, bonuses aren't simply "free money," and understanding the associated terms and conditions is vital. Wagering requirements, often exp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ount, dictate how much a player must wager before being able to with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. It is also crucial to consider any game restrictions, as some games may contribute less or not at all tow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Careful evaluation of these conditions is essential for determining the true value of a bonus and whether it aligns with a player’s gaming strategy.
Beyond welcome bonuses, many platforms offer a variety of ongoing promotions, including deposit bonuses, free spins, cashback offers, and loyalty programs. Taking advantage of these offers can significantly boost a player's bankroll and extend their playing time. However, it’s important to avoid the temptation of chasing bonuses if the wagering requirements are excessively high or the game restrictions are unfavorable. A disciplined approach to bonus utilization is key to maximizing their benefits.

Responsible Gaming and Bankroll Management
While the allure of winning big is a significant draw for many players, responsible gaming and effective bankroll management are paramount for long-term success and enjoyment. Setting a budget and adhering to it rigidly is crucial. This involves determining a specific amount of money that a player is willing to lose without impacting their financial stability and then resisting the temptation to exceed that limit. It’s vital to view casino gaming as a form of entertainment, rather than a reliable source of income, and to only wager with funds that can be comfortably afforded to be lost.
Furthermore, avoiding the "chasing losses" mentality is essential. Attempting to recoup losses by increasing wagers can quickly lead to a downward spiral and deplete a bankroll. Instead, it’s important to accept losses as part of the game and to walk away when reaching a predetermined loss limit. Taking regular breaks and avoiding extended gaming sessions can also help maintain a clear head and prevent impulsive decisions. Remembering that the house always has an edge is a fundamental principle of responsible gaming.

Advanced Strategies for Specific Games
Different games require different strategies. In blackjack, for example, basic strategy charts provide optimal playing decisions based on the player's hand and the dealer's upcard. Mastering basic strategy can significantly reduce the house edge and improve a player's odds. In poker, understanding hand rankings, pot odds, and opponent tendencies is crucial for making profitable decisions. For slot machines, while outcomes are largely random, understanding the paytable and selecting games with higher RTP percentages can increase a player's chances of winning. Exploring Emerging Trends in Gaming
Beyond the technological advancements, a crucial trend is the increasing emphasis on player protection and responsible gaming. Regulatory bodies and platform operators are working together to implement stricter measures to prevent problem gambling and protect vulnerable individuals. This includes features such as self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and reality checks. Another emerging trend is the growing demand for provably fair games, which utilize cryptographic algorithms to ensure that game outcomes are genuinely random and transparent. This trend towards increased fairness and transparency is likely to gain momentum as players become more aware of the importance of these factors.
